The Graphic Designer is a creative and detail-oriented professional. He/She is responsible for designing visually compelling print and digital marketing materials, including advertisements, social media graphics, email campaigns, and event promotions. Additionally, the Graphic Designer will play a key role in developing seminar content manuals and other educational materials, ensuring brand consistency and high-quality design standards. He/She is highly proficient in design software, has strong layout and typography skills, and can collaborate effectively across departments to bring creative concepts to life.
Job Responsibilities
Print and Digital Marketing Design
- Design and produce marketing collateral such as brochures, flyers, banners, and signage for events and campaigns
- Develop digital assets for social media, websites, email marketing, and online advertising
- Ensure brand consistency across all marketing materials and maintain design templates
- Collaborate with the marketing team to conceptualize and execute creative campaigns
- Leverage and integrate AI tools in the design process to enhance efficiency, generate concepts, and automate repetitive tasks
- Develop clear and concise prompts to generate outputs, engineer design possibilities
Seminar Content and Manual Creation
- Design and format seminar content manuals, workbooks, and training materials for both print and digital distribution
- Ensure layouts are visually appealing, easy to read, and align with branding guidelines
- Work closely with content creators, instructional designers, and event planners to optimize seminar materials for clarity and engagement
Collaboration and Project Management
- Work cross-functionally with marketing, events, and content teams to support various design needs
- Manage multiple projects simultaneously while meeting deadlines and quality standards
- Coordinate with external vendors, printers, and production teams for print and promotional materials
- Stay up to date on industry trends and best practices in graphic design, marketing, and branding
Job Requirements
- 4+ years of professional experience in graphic design, preferably in marketing, branding, or educational content design (e.g., manuals, workbooks)
- Strong skills in motion graphics and animation (especially in After Effects and Premiere Pro) are a big plus
- Must be proficient in Adobe Creative Suite (Photoshop, Illustrator, InDesign, Acrobat)
- Must have experience with layout design, typography, and print production; Figma experience is ideal
- Experience integrating AI tools into the creative workflow to improve efficiency, concept development, and visual experimentation
- A strong portfolio that demonstrates creativity, technical design skills, and relevant graphic design experience
- Must have knowledge of digital design best practices for web and social media
- Must be familiar with PowerPoint, Canva, Gamma or other presentation design tools
- Must possess a strong attention to detail and ability to work independently
- Must have excellent time management and ability to handle multiple projects
- Must have strong communication and collaboration skills
- Must be a proactive, creative problem solver with a passion for design and branding
- Must have familiarity with UX/UI principles for digital content
- Bachelor’s degree in Graphic Design, Visual Arts, or a related field (or equivalent experience)
- Previous experience in the events, training, or corporate education industry is a plus
